Limitations
What We Don’t Treat Online
For certain emergencies, in-person care is essential. Please go directly to a hospital or call emergency services if you experience:
- Severe altitude symptoms — confusion or inability to walk (descend immediately)
- Major trauma or uncontrolled bleeding
- Chest pain or severe shortness of breath
- Signs of stroke (sudden numbness, speech difficulty)
- High fever in small children
- Conditions requiring immediate hospitalization
📞 Emergency Numbers in Peru
- General Emergency (SAMU) Call 106
- Police (PNP) Call 105
- Fire Department (Bomberos) Call 116
- Hospital Regional Cusco +51 84 223-691
- Clínica Ricardo Palma, Lima +51 1 224-2224
